Transaction ef2232bd631fb25489625ac57b9ea40dd4a04da36e8261ac998e349d362048e6
1 Input
1 Output
-
ef2232bd631fb25489625ac57b9ea40dd4a04da36e8261ac998e349d362048e6:0
- value
- 787773
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c46f207f671ec5f17ff3d37ceb79a4d0272efb8a OP_EQUAL
- address
- 3KbfVNsfvjPPV7iTH5zkdzg49MDt67ChmY